1. Function
It is the water based degreasing, which the main part is surface
active agent, do not include strong acid, does not have toxicity,
oxidability and flamability. Good cleaning and rust removal. Its
water waste discharge is in line with the requirements of
enviroment protecting.
2. Application
As its function of low foaming and high efficiency, most suit to
eliminate the polishing wax oil from carcon steel, cast iron,
stainless steel, brass alloy , aluminium alloy, zinc alloy etc. use
to clean under normal temperature; also can instead of trichloro
ethylene to ultrasonic clean for the sake of lower the cost.

4. main part and its contents:
non-ionic surface active agent | emulsifier | coconut oil alcohol amide | detergent |
60% | 25% | 10% | 5% |
5. technological parameter
Proportion :1.4-1.5g/ml | Use viscosity:3-5% |
Handle temperature:60-90℃ | Handle time:5-10Mins.(also can depend on the material of workpiece) |
6. How to cleanup the Wax:
(1). Adjust the temperature of ultrasonic water to 70℃
(2). Pour on the wax cleanup water;
(3). Place the work pieces on the cleanup wax pendant, then put in
the liquid to clean.
(4). The Cleanup time can depend on the workpiece, (normally
1-10mins), then inspect the workpiece to reach the good result.
(5). After degrease and cleanup the wax, clean the remained agent
by water, then go to the next procedure.
7. matters need attention
Not corrosive, not poisonous, no chemical reation with normal
metal. The wax cleanup effect and speed of the solution can be
worked out by chemical calculation, or maintained by add wax
cleanup water upon experience, later if too much oil and wax
inside, must change the solution, usually 2-6days.
